Atlas Management is seeking a Healthcare Recruitment Coordinator to join a prominent organization.The Healthcare Recruitment Coordinator plays a vital role within the HR team, focusing on both internal and external job posting processes, evaluating applications for essential qualifications, and recommending suitable candidates for subsequent stages in the hiring process.
This position provides guidance and oversight to facility HR teams concerning the applicant tracking system (ATS), as well as the selection and processing of applications.
The role involves identifying recruitment challenges at facilities and contributing to the development of effective solutions.This position is well-suited for individuals who have a keen eye for detail, can handle confidential information with discretion, and maintain a positive attitude.
Key Responsibilities:
The successful candidate will be expected to perform the following tasks at a level consistent with job performance standards.
Administers the established internal and external ATS posting procedures for designated facilities and/or roles.Conducts initial screenings to provide facilities with qualified candidates for interviews regarding open roles.
Engages with facilities and/or recruiters for nursing positions throughout the selection process and reviews documentation to ensure that roles have been filled and candidates have been appropriately processed.
Manages the processing of expired applications at the relevant review status.Assists candidates with the online application process and addresses employment inquiries promptly.
Supports hiring managers with inquiries and the implementation of recruitment best practices at local facilities.
Utilizes specific technologies and software, including but not limited to, Text Recruit, Phenom, Microsoft Teams, JD Edwards (JDE), and Indeed for candidate processing.
Ensures adherence to state and federal regulations governing selection, hiring, and employment.Qualifications:
A degree from an accredited college or university is required, or alternatively, 5 years of experience in recruitment.
A minimum of one year of experience in recruitment or human resources that includes recruitment and/or employment processing is necessary.
Additional relevant experience may be considered in lieu of the required education on a year-for-year basis.
A professional demeanor and the ability to maintain confidentiality are essential.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ications and experience with an HRIS or ATS system are required.
Domestic travel may be necessary.
A valid driver's license is mandatory.
